Here are some winter footwear tips shared by Ronnie Khanna from the brand
Saint G
Lace up boots
One of the biggest fall-winter fashion trends is lace up boots. There are so
many to name like over-the-knee, below the knees, ankle lace-up boots. These
boots gives the impression of channelling with your dresses. Pair your lace-up
boots with lacy white summer dress with a leather jacket or blazer and looks
cute when paired with leggings, a tunic, and a printed scarf.
Combat boots
Make a fancy feminine dress work for the daytime by pairing it with combat
boots. It makes the look way more casual. Combat boots toughen up floral
dresses, and make them look more appropriate for fall weather. This boots can
make you look grown up.
Thigh high boots
Style yourself with thigh-highs and a coat for a more seasonally appropriate
feel. If you're wearing a lot of black or dark tones, a lighter-coloured boot
provides some contrast and helps soften your look, while maintaining its edgy
vibe. If you're wearing a simple outfit, adding other interesting accents, such
as an embellished belt and fringe purse, will make your look feel more
complete.
Ankle boots
Throw fashion rules out the window and wear your ankle boots with visible
socks pulled up and a skirt. Add a leather jacket for some added toughness.
Ankle boots look amazing with a maxi dress or skirt. In the colder weather,
throw on a jacket or cardigan.
